The Sony Ericsson W205 is another new addition to the company long lists o f cellphone gadgets. This Walkman phone is a new entry that is designed for first-time mobile phone buyers or so it appears.
It comes with a host of features that will make buyers want to always hook up with it. This slider handset that is GSM/GPRS compliant offers the Walkman music player, FM radio and TrackID music identifying software and M2 memory card support up to 2GB only. Also, there’s a 1.3-megapixel camera, Bluetooth connectivity, and “multiple” phone books to keep contacts “in order” even if someone needs to borrow the phone enabling you to to separate your contact list without having outsiders pollute it with theirs should you lend them your phone. There is no word yet about the price but the Sony Ericsson W205 is expected to hit the market soon.
